1. Refreshing Watermelon and Feta Salad
This salad is a delightful blend of sweet and savory, perfect for a hot summer day. Simply combine cubed watermelon, crumbled feta cheese, fresh mint leaves, and a drizzle of balsamic glaze. It’s a hydrating and satisfying dish that takes minutes to prepare.

2. Greek Yogurt Parfait
A quick and nutritious option for breakfast or a mid-day snack. Layer Greek yogurt with fresh berries, a sprinkle of granola, and a drizzle of honey. This parfait is high in protein and antioxidants, keeping you energized and full.

3. Rainbow Veggie Wraps
For a light yet filling meal, try veggie wraps. Spread hummus on a whole wheat tortilla, then add your favorite colorful veggies like bell peppers, cucumbers, carrots, and spinach. Roll it up and enjoy a crunchy, flavorful wrap that’s rich in vitamins and fiber.

4. Caprese Skewers
A fun and easy appetizer or snack. Skewer cherry tomatoes, fresh basil leaves, and mozzarella balls. Drizzle with olive oil and balsamic vinegar, and sprinkle with a pinch of salt and pepper. These skewers are a burst of summer flavors in every bite.

5. Avocado Toast with a Twist
Mash a ripe avocado and spread it on whole grain toast. Top with sliced radishes, tomatoes, a sprinkle of hemp seeds, and a dash of lemon juice. This version of avocado toast adds a bit of crunch and a lot of nutrients, making it a perfect no-cook meal.

6. Chilled Gazpacho
Blend together tomatoes, cucumbers, bell peppers, garlic, onion, olive oil, and a splash of vinegar. Chill in the refrigerator for a few hours. Serve cold with a garnish of fresh herbs. This Spanish classic is refreshing and packed with nutrients.

7. Berry Spinach Salad
Mix fresh spinach with a variety of berries (strawberries, blueberries, raspberries) and top with goat cheese and walnuts. Drizzle with a light vinaigrette. This salad is a powerhouse of antioxidants, healthy fats, and vitamins.
